reflecting on trinity

In early August I had the opportunity to spend five nights (six days) backpacking in the Trinity Alps Wilderness of Northern California, about five hours north of San Francisco. It was beautiful, peaceful, meditative, and at points exhausting.

Though I took many photos (which I am still sorting) this is one of my favorites. It is the reflection of morning clouds on Diamond Lake, while waiting for the coffee water to boil. I was captivated by the blue of the sky, the puffs of white from the clouds, and the green of the grass fresh from the dew of the morning.
